Turkey set to open Bursa Textile Show Fair from October

Turkey is set to open Bursa Textile Show (BURTEX) Fair on October 18, 2022, with over 40 foreign buyers from more than 500 countries expected to witness the upcoming autumn-winter fabric and accessory collections at the Merinos Atatürk Congress Culture Centre.

As many as 137 textile manufacturers would put their products for the 2023-2024 autumn – winter seasons on display with the support of the Ministry of Trade. Bursa, being a large city in northwest Turkey, lying in the foothills of roughly 2,500m-high Mount Uludağ near the Sea of Marmara, will host the largest garment fabric fair in the region until October 20, where more than 500 target countries, especially Russia, Spain, Italy, and England, will visit the fair.

Global Fair Agency (KFA), a fair organization company, has joined hands with the Ministry of Trade to make it a success story in fast-changing textile demands worldwide. Some 40 foreign business professionals will assemble to appreciate the Turkish innovations in the textile sector and fashion-shaping products.

İsmail Kuş, Vice Chairman of the BTSO Board of Directors, said that they aim to make Bursa, the production and export centre of the Turkish economy, as it has become the region’s most extensive garment fabric fair today.

“Our fair has become an important brand in the textile sector in Bursa, increasing the number and quality of visitors each year. I would like to thank our textile industry representatives who have taken care of the fair since the first day and all our stakeholders who supported the organisation of our fair,” he said.
